Census Bureau: More women than men in Faulkton in 2020
Of the 819 people living in Faulkton in 2020, 54.1 percent (443) were women and 45.9 percent (376) were men,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the Central South Dakota News.

Census Bureau: 77.7 percent of people in Faulk County were old enough to vote in 2019
Of the 2,312 citizens living in Faulk County in 2019, 1,797 were old enough to vote as of Jan. 26,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.

Census Bureau: 0.5% of people in Faulk County identified as multi-racial in 2019
Of the 2,312 citizens living in Faulk County in 2019, 99.5 percent said they were only one race, while 0.5 percent said they were two or more races,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ained in January.

Census Bureau: 76.4 percent of people in Faulkton were old enough to vote in 2019
Of the 831 citizens living in Faulkton in 2019, 635 were old enough to vote as of Jan. 26,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.

Census Bureau: 1.3% of people in Faulkton identified as multi-racial in 2019
Of the 831 citizens living in Faulkton in 2019, 98.7 percent said they were only one race, while 1.3 percent said they were two or more races,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ained in January.
